What is the difference between the Ledger Nano S and the Ledger Nano X in terms of digital currency storage?
Can you explain the key differences between the Ledger Nano S and the Ledger Nano X when it comes to storing digital currencies securely?
3 answers
- Teoh Zhen YingOct 17, 2021 · 5 years agoThe Ledger Nano S and the Ledger Nano X are both hardware wallets designed for secure storage of digital currencies. However, there are a few key differences between the two. The Nano S is a more compact and affordable option, while the Nano X offers more advanced features and a larger screen. Additionally, the Nano X has Bluetooth connectivity, allowing you to manage your digital currencies on the go using your smartphone. Overall, if you're looking for a budget-friendly option, the Nano S is a great choice. But if you want more convenience and advanced features, the Nano X is worth considering.
